The Entourage effect
The entourage effect is the theory that suggests different terpenes and cannabis can are able to create stronger effects than when used in isolation. This is similar to the way the band Jagger and Richards sound better when they are together than they do without one another. This is the same for CBD and other compounds. Some people prefer full spectrum CBD products to isolate.
A full spectrum product is one that includes all the cannabinoids that are found in the cannabis plant, as well as the small amount of THC. The amount of THC in a product will not usually be enough to make you feel high, but it may enhance the effects from the other cannabinoids. These products contain THC and may cause you to fail a drug screen if taken in large amounts or over a long period of time.

CBD's anti-inflammatory effects
CBD is a powerful anti-inflammatory drug, with clinical studies revealing that CBD reduces the production of proinflammatory cytokines and reduces the adhesion of immune cells to cell membranes. It also functions as an adenosine agonist naturally which triggers the release of the chemical adenosine that reduces inflammation in the body, by blocking the activity of inflammatory molecule.
This Webpage anti-inflammatory effect is what makes CBD so helpful in treating the autoimmune diseases such as arthritis and Lupus, as well as other conditions such as psoriasis, which can trigger itching, redness, and inflammation of joints and the skin. CBD has been shown to block the abnormal immune response that is associated with these ailments, and can even lead to an end of the cycle. This is a great alternative to harsh pharmaceutical drugs that can cause unwanted side effects.
Another way in which CBD can fight inflammation is through interactions with the PPARg receptor which is involved in the body's antioxidant process. Studies have shown that when CBD interacts with this receptor, it stimulates a protective mechanism that prevents neuronal damage due to an oxidative stress, and also protects the brain from inflammation. These findings suggest that CBD can aid in the fight against neurodegenerative disorders like Alzheimer's and Parkinson's.

CBD's Pain Relieving effects
CBD has been found to be an effective analgesic. In one study, CBD reduced neuropathic pain in mice caused by surgery or chemical administration (the chemical therapy drug Paclitaxel) when combined with low doses of morphine and also prevented the development of tolerance to morphine [96]. It is believed that the anti-nociceptive properties of CBD are mediated by a variety of pathways. CBD for instance, can activate the serotonine receptors via 5HT1a or the glycine receptors. It increases their conductance by up to 1,000-fold when micromolar amounts are present. CBD also blocks voltage-gated sodium channels and Cav3.1 while enhancing the conductivity of the cationic Calcium channel Cav3.2.
